Brief Summary
This study aimed to determine the psychosocial effects of exercise training in patients with rotator cuff tears.
Detailed Description
This study aimed to determine the psychosocial effects of exercise training in patients with rotator cuff tears. Fifty voluntary patients with partial rotator cuff tear will be randomized into two gro...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Forty years of age or older patients that have been diagnosed for a partial rotator cuff tear that is unrelated to trauma by a specialist orthopedist with MRI and physical examination and no other shoulder problems on the diagnosed shoulder will be included into this study.
Exclusion
- Patients diagnosed with full-thickness or massive rotator cuff tear, patients who undergone previous surgery, patients diagnosed with frozen shoulder or glenohumeral instability, and athletic patients younger than 40 years of age with symptoms of acute RC tear will not be included into this study.
